What are the top public quantum computing companies in the cryptocurrency industry?

D-Wave Systems: D-Wave is a Canadian company that specializes in quantum computing systems. They have been involved in various cryptocurrency-related projects and have partnered with companies like 1QBit and Volkswagen to explore the potential of quantum computing in the industry. 2. IBM: IBM is one of the leading companies in the field of quantum computing. They have developed a quantum computer called IBM Q System One and have been actively researching the applications of quantum computing in various industries, including cryptocurrency. 3. Rigetti Computing: Rigetti Computing is a California-based company that focuses on building and deploying quantum computers. While they haven't specifically targeted the cryptocurrency industry, their quantum computing technology has the potential to impact various sectors, including finance and cryptography. 4. Honeywell: Honeywell is a multinational conglomerate that has recently entered the quantum computing space. They have developed a quantum computer called System Model H1 and are exploring its applications in different industries, including finance and encryption. Please note that this list is not exhaustive, and there are other companies and research institutions actively working on quantum computing in the cryptocurrency industry. These companies, however, represent some of the most prominent players in the field.
